Understanding Skin Types

Importance of knowing your skin type. How to identify your skin type.

Knowing your skin type is like finding the right pair of shoes. If they fit well, you walk confidently! Without this knowledge, your skin care can feel like a wild goose chase. To identify your skin type, wash your face and wait for an hour. If your skin feels tight, you might have dry skin. If it’s shiny everywhere, you may have oily skin. Combination skin means you get both in different areas, and normal skin is just… well, normal.

Skin Type Characteristics
Dry Tight, flaky, or rough
Oily Shiny and greasy
Combination Both dry and oily areas
Normal Balanced, not too dry or oily

Incorporating Serums and Treatments

Types of serums suitable for morning use. How to layer products effectively.

Serums can boost your skin in the morning. They help with moisture and glow. Here are some kinds that work great:

  • Vitamin C Serum: Brightens skin and fights spots.
  • Hyaluronic Acid: Locks in moisture for a plump look.
  • Niacinamide: Reduces redness and smooths skin.

Layering products is simple! Start with the lightest serum first. Follow with heavier creams. Wait a minute between each product. This helps your skin absorb them better. Together, these steps keep your skin happy and healthy.

What are good serums for morning use?

Good serums include Vitamin C, Hyaluronic Acid, and Niacinamide. They refresh your skin and help it look bright.

Sun Protection: A Non-Negotiable Step

Importance of SPF in your routine. Types of sunscreen: Chemical vs. physical.

Protecting your skin from the sun is very important for keeping it healthy. Using SPF helps prevent sunburn and skin damage. Everyone should add sunscreen to their morning routine. There are two types of sunscreen:

  • Chemical Sunscreens: These absorb UV rays. They can feel lighter on the skin.
  • Physical Sunscreens: These sit on top of the skin. They block UV rays and are great for sensitive skin.

Remember, wearing sunscreen helps keep your skin youthful and glowing!

Why is SPF important for my skin?

SPF protects against harmful sun rays, reducing the risk of skin cancer and aging.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Overexfoliating and its effects. Using harsh products that dry out the skin.

Many people make common mistakes in their skin care routine. One big mistake is overexfoliating. This means scrubbing or using too many products that remove skin cells. It can make your skin dry and irritated. Another mistake is using harsh products. These products can strip away moisture, leaving your skin feeling tight and rough.

  • Limit exfoliating to once or twice a week.
  • Choose gentle products suitable for your skin type.
  • Listen to your skin—if it feels dry, stop using harsh items.

What happens if I overexfoliate my skin?

Overexfoliation can lead to redness, irritation, and even breakouts. It’s like wearing down the protective layer of your skin. Remember to exfoliate gently for healthy, happy skin!

What Ingredients Should I Look For In A Morning Skincare Regimen Without Toner For Different Skin Types?

For dry skin, look for ingredients like hyaluronic acid and glycerin. They help keep your skin soft and hydrated. If you have oily skin, choose lightweight gel products with salicylic acid. This helps keep your skin clear. If your skin is sensitive, look for calming ingredients like aloe vera and chamomile. These can soothe your skin and reduce redness.
